3 reviews for San Carlos Inn
We were going to a wedding down in Monterey and needed to find a place to stay for 3 nights that wouldn't break the bank. We were having a hard time finding something because the Big Sur Marathon was happening when I came across this hotel's website. I was a little hesitant to book a room because I wondered how it was that this place was the only one in the area not booked solid. But, I pushed those paranoid feelings aside figuring Days Inns are fairly reliable and how bad could it be in downtown Monterey?! When we arrived, we found out that we were actually staying in the Annex which is right behind the main hotel. It turned out to be a bonus because you're off the main street so it's much quieter. Plenty of parking too. We were really happy when we got to the room and saw how large it was. The bed was fairly comfortable and amenities were fine. The front desk staff was very helpful getting us information for a taxi and came right to the room with a replacement hairdryer when we realized the one in the room didn't work.
The location is great. A 10 minute walk to Fisherman's Wharf where the whale watching boats dock and about a 30 minute walk to Cannery Row and the Monterey Bay Aquarium. Plenty of restaurants and cafe within a stones throw and the Del Monte Mall is just up the street.
We'd definitely stay there again.
Found this place through the budget travel deal sites. Was impressed with the quality of this place. Clean rooms, not too small, affordable and located just off the main strip of downtown Monterey. We walked everywhere we went, the aquarium being the furthest at about 1.5 miles away.
Checked in and JD helped us out. Real nice guy. If it's sleep and a shower you're looking for, this is the place.
I cannot stress enough how this is the best hotel in Monterey for it's price. Any cheaper and you're actually in Sand City. Any closer to the downtown or the Cannery area and you're looking at paying up to three times as much per night. It's clean, comfy and all around a great place to stay.
